## Introduce per-tenant rate quotas in the Orvane gateway

For the release manager: this change replaces our global throttle with per-tenant quotas, resolved at request time from the tenant registry and cached for sixty seconds. Tenants without an explicit quota inherit the tier default; overage returns a retryable status with a hint header. Rollout is gated behind a flag, defaulting off, and the old throttle remains as a backstop until two clean release cycles pass.

The initial tier defaults we intend to ship are listed below.

limits module of taguf-hafog:
WEIGHTS = {
    "wenox": 690,
    "wenok": 782,
    "kelax": 41,
    "holox": 338,
    "quenir": 39,
}

- [ ] Step 7: Archive cold storage buckets (Glacierline tier). Confirm both ceremony witnesses are present, verify bucket manifests match the Oxbow ledger, then seal the archive key shares. Plugin authors may observe but not handle shares. Once sealed, the archive index itself is encrypted and can only be reopened with the passphrase below.

vault phrase of badup-hahig = tamael-aldael-kelmir-istael-fenok-istwyn-tamius-jorath-oliion

Ticket: SNAP-774 — Snapshot tests flaking on the Wrenfield component kit. Button and Card snapshots diff on every CI run; font metrics vary between the hosted runners. Pin the render container image and regenerate baselines. On-call: do not approve snapshot updates until the container pin lands, or we bury real regressions. Repro is deterministic inside the pinned image. The CI build token for the last clean run is below.

session token of tajef-bageg = htk21_5d90d574934f3ccae6437

Checklist item 7 — Off-site backup tapes. Confirm the weekly tape set from the Branner Hill server room is sealed in the grey transit case before the off-site run leaves at 14:00. The case must be logged out by the duty supervisor and placed in the locked compartment of the van, not on the passenger seat. Verify the seal number matches the log. The courier hand-over instruction for the Oakmere vault follows below.

dispatch memo: the lamwyn fenwyn courier leaves the wenir ledger at gate 7175 under passcode 822969